Transaction ea40de1732f8e95a6272b9a455afaf322b5777914dc5c7acf404aefdaddb3e5e
1 Input
1 Output
-
ea40de1732f8e95a6272b9a455afaf322b5777914dc5c7acf404aefdaddb3e5e:0
- value
- 1353829
- script pubkey
- OP_0 OP_PUSHBYTES_32 943cf222f290cc7ebeb8437b50ed665520cadbbedd4325aae80d278b46cc8bca
- address
- bc1qjs70yghjjrx8a04cgda4pmtx25sv4ka7m4pjt2hgp5nck3kv309qwpx2qv